The bq Aquaris M5.5 Essential is here, is it worth its little evolution?

The Spanish company bq has put into play a new terminal that, in reality, is a small variation of one of those it already has on the market. We talk about bq Aquaris M5.5 Essential, a device that offers on the screen the great difference with respect to the model from which it was “born”, the Aquaris M5.5.

Despite the busy times that the company is living, especially in what has to do with its workforce, it seems that the company maintains some muscle to launch a new Android device that offers a 5,5-inch screen but that changes resolution : goes from 1080p to 720p. This has as a direct consequence that the price of the bq Aquaris M5.5 Essential is $239,90, which is twenty less than the cheapest model with a Full HD panel.

The rest of its characteristics

Well, as I have indicated, these remain almost all unflappable, for example that the operating system is Android 5.1 -an update in this section would not have been bad-; that offers compatibility with LTE networks; main chamber of 13 megapixels with aperture f / 20; And, of course, it includes NFC connectivity.

The rest of details of the bq Aquaris M5.5 Essential are those indicated below and clearly position it in the mid-range of product:

  • Qualcomm Octa-core Snapdragon 615 processor
  • 2 GB of RAM
  • Battery 3.620 mAh
  • 16 expandable storage
  • Supports Dolby Atmos and has radio
